Overview

Sewage cleaning trucks, also known as vacuum sewer cleaners, are heavy-duty vehicles engineered for sanitation and industrial applications. They combine high-pressure water spraying with powerful vacuum suction to remove solid and liquid waste from underground pipes, storage tanks, and drainage systems. These specialized trucks play a critical role in urban infrastructure maintenance, preventing blockages and ensuring proper wastewater flow. Modern versions often include advanced features like CCTV inspection systems and GPS tracking for efficient operation management.

Structure and Working Principle

The core components include a chassis-mounted vacuum pump, debris collection tank (typically 3–10 m³ capacity), high-pressure water pump (100–300 bar), and an array of hoses and nozzles. The system operates by first loosening debris with pressurized water, then extracting the slurry through a vacuum hose into the sealed storage tank. Most models feature a rear-mounted operator panel with joystick controls for precision cleaning. Advanced systems may include debris separation technology to filter solids from liquids, reducing disposal volume. The trucks are commonly built on commercial truck chassis with 4×2 or 6×4 configurations for urban or off-road use respectively.

Key Features

Modern sewage cleaning trucks offer several technical advantages. Hydraulic systems provide reliable power for both water jets and vacuum pumps, often with 300–500 HP engines. Stainless steel or polypropylene tanks ensure corrosion resistance, while quick-dump mechanisms facilitate efficient waste disposal. Many units now incorporate digital controls with pressure monitoring and automatic shut-off systems. Optional attachments include root cutters for pipe blockages and odor control systems for sensitive urban environments. Safety features typically include emergency stop buttons, tank overfill prevention, and explosion-proof designs for hazardous environments.

Application Areas

Municipal governments deploy these trucks for routine sewer maintenance and emergency flood response. They're indispensable for preventing urban drainage system failures that can lead to street flooding and public health hazards. Industrial applications include cleaning refinery sumps, food processing waste tanks, and chemical plant containment areas. Construction sites use smaller versions for pit dewatering. Some specialized models serve marine applications, cleaning ship ballast tanks and port facilities with ATEX-rated explosion-proof equipment.

Maintenance and Precautions

Regular maintenance should include daily pump lubrication, weekly inspection of hoses and seals, and monthly tank interior cleaning. The vacuum pump requires oil changes every 500 operating hours, while water jet nozzles need periodic replacement due to wear. Operators must wear PPE including gloves, goggles, and respiratory protection when handling hazardous waste. The vehicle should always be stabilized with outriggers before operation to prevent tipping. Special care is required when working near electrical hazards or confined spaces with potential gas accumulation.

B2B Procurement Guide

When sourcing sewage cleaning trucks, evaluate the specific requirements of your operation. Municipal buyers should prioritize durability and serviceability, often opting for domestic manufacturers with available spare parts. Industrial users may need specialized configurations like chemical-resistant coatings or explosion-proof certification. Consider total cost of ownership including fuel efficiency, maintenance intervals, and expected service life (typically 7–10 years). Leasing options are available for seasonal operations. Leading manufacturers offer customization for tank capacity (commonly 5–15 cubic meters), additional storage compartments, or alternative power sources like electric-hybrid systems.
